White skin on your lips may be due to dryness or lip licking, leading to flaky patches. Staying hydrated and using a lip balm with sunscreen can help. If accompanied by irritation or persists, consult a dermatologist to check for conditions like cheilitis or allergies. Avoid irritants like harsh lip products and exfoliate gently. Maintaining this routine can ensure healthier lips and prevent future issues.

- What causes white skin on the lips? White skin on the lips can be caused by dryness, lip licking, or exposure to irritants. It may also indicate underlying conditions like cheilitis or allergies.
- How can I prevent white patches on my lips? To prevent white patches on your lips, stay hydrated, use a moisturizing lip balm with sunscreen, avoid licking your lips, and refrain from using harsh lip products.
- When should I see a dermatologist for lip issues? Consult a dermatologist if you experience persistent white patches accompanied by irritation, redness, or pain, as it may indicate an underlying condition that requires treatment.
- What are the best treatments for dry, flaky lips? For dry, flaky lips, use hydrating lip balms, exfoliate gently, and ensure you are hydrated. Sun protection is also important to maintain lip health.
